内容列表
Struts环境配置手顺(eclipse版)
Struts环境配置手记1.Eclipse  下载网址:  http://www.eclipse.org/2.tomcat  下载网址:  http://jakarta.apache.org/site/binindex.cgi3.struts  下载网址:  http://jak
分类:Java 查阅全文
Java 库的建立方法及其实例
任何一种面向对象语言都有它的库。任何一种面向对象的语言也都离不开库的支持。用我们熟悉的面向对象语言为例子,C++有STL,Java有API函数,具体到开发工具,Visual C++提供了MFC, Borland C++提供了OWL。也有很多第三方提供的库。我们在开发应用程序的时候,也发觉我们也许需要某些特定的库来完成特定的功能。那么,如何编写自己的库呢? 利用Java的面向对象特性,如封装,继承
分类:Java 查阅全文
Java中的等式
比较原始类型的相等与比较两个对象相等是不同的。如果数值5存放在两个不同的int变量中,比较两个变量是否相等将产生结果为 boolean 值 true: public class TestIntComparison { public static void main(String[] args) { int x = 5, y = 5; System.out.prin
分类:Java 查阅全文
MIDlet中对图片等资源文件的存取
通过测试发现,在MIDlet中可以用目录的方式对某类资源文件归类存放,运行的时候可以正常存取。程序示例如下 ……  String[] imgPath = {"/srcs/byf_banshenyinliao.png","/srcs/fxh_byf_heying.png",    "/srcs/fxh_half_120.p
分类:Java 查阅全文
使用MIDP2.0开发游戏 (4) 改进的地图生成方式
上次我们用Sprite实现了背景,但是这样不便于通过地图数据生成地图。通常,游戏中的地图都被分成NxN的方格,一般仅有几种图案。幸运的是,SUN在MIDP 2.0已经考虑到了游戏开发者需要的这个功能,TiledLayer便是通过贴图实现的层,它的使用同样异常简单! 首先准备好我们需要的小块区域,在坦克大战的地图中,一共有下面5种:  (注意这是放大的jpg格式,你需要处理成40x
分类:Java 查阅全文
Eclipse3.0中安装Lomboz 3.01
1.安装jdk1.4.0或者以上版本,安装Tomcat; 2.从http://www.eclipse.org/下载Eclipse最新的版本; 3.从http://www.eclipse.org/emf下载 EMF 2.0.(很重要,由于配合Eclipse3.0的Lomboz利用了基于eclipse EMF project的模块,所以需要EMF runtime环境。) 4.从http://ww
分类:Java 查阅全文
历时5个月做的Echo Eclipse插件
从不懂Java,到熟悉Java, 熟悉Eclipse插件开发,看透GEF, 初通EMF,5个月,搞出了这么个粗陋的东西 (另外特别感谢老板和老大的宽容与耐心) 主界面 向导 导航
分类:Java 查阅全文
JAVA生成SVG图表实例之柱状图
做系统的时候都要配合报表展示一些图表,例如柱状图、饼图还有曲线图,以前是用VML做成通用的,数值的计算和VML在页面上的显示,全部是用javascript做的,可是VML中的文字定位不是特别舒服,javascript计算数字也不是很精确。最近学了几天SVG,觉得不错,所以就想用JAVA生成SVG文件,然后显示,网上没有类似的文章,所以我就把自己的第一个作品放出来,希望大家能够提点向我提电意见,改进
分类:Java 查阅全文
开始学习BEPL
ebPML.org 一个学习bepl的站点 Web服务业务流程执行语言(BPEL)是一种编程语言,它明确定义了基于Web服务的业务流程。BPEL在支持业务伙伴间的长时间会话方面表现尤为卓越。BPEL将成为基于Web服务的业务流程最广泛采用的标准,这一趋势早在该标准正式发布前就已经非常明显。 BPEL适用于支持业务流程逻辑的“宏观编程”。这些业务流程均是完整而独立的应用
分类:Java 查阅全文
Servlet和JSP的线程安全问题
编写Servlet和JSP的时候,线程安全问题很容易被忽略,如果忽视了这个问题,你的程序就存在潜在的隐患. 1.Servlet的生命周期Servlet的生命周期是由Web容器负责的,当客户端第一次请求Servlet时,容器负责初始化Servlet,也就是实例化这个Servlet类.以后这个实例就负责客户端的请求,一般不会再实例化其他Servlet类,也就是有多个线程在使用这个实例.Servlet
分类:Java 查阅全文
实例变量与类变量的区别
  昨晚翻一翻新买的JAVA入门书,突然看到JAVA中变量分为三种:  1.本地变量 2.实例变量 3.类变量  本地变量很好理解,作用域及生命期都和DELPHI函数内部中变量一样,但2,3种就有些费解了,上网查了查资料,找到答案。  实例变量就是当一个类有多个实例时,变量存在的个数的实例一样多,即意味着一个实例拥有一个实例变量的操作权,并且不能更改其它实例中的实例变量。  而类变量其实就有些像D
分类:Java 查阅全文
在Java中基于UDP协议编程
        在Java中进行网络编程是相对容易的,因为J2SE中的java.net包已经对各种通信协议很好的进行了封装,本文主要讲述如何基于UDP(用户数据报)协议编写应用程序。         通常我们进行网络编程一般都是使用基于socket的TCP/
分类:Java 查阅全文
hiberfil.sys为什么会被认作folder 而不是 file?
File f = new File("c:\\hiberfil.sys");//下面应该是true,但却是false。//不信你试试看//Why?System.out.println(f.isFile()); java version "1.4.2_05"Java(TM) 2 Runtime Environment, Standard Edition (build 1.4.2_05-b04)Ja
分类:Java 查阅全文
Core Java Internationalization
今天突然要涉及到国际化的一个问题,备忘Core Java Internationalization。CJKV Information Processing一书已经由O'Reilly-TW出版了,O'Reilly-CN好像还没有什么动静。 另:不知道是不是Google改变了页面查询选项,在新页面中打开而非直接点击到链接?  
分类:Java 查阅全文
swing中调用文件选择对话框
import javax.swing.*;...public class jCutter extends JFrame { private JTextField textField; private JButton button; private JFileChooser fDialog; private JFrame frame;... &nbs
分类:Java 查阅全文
关于开发高手2004第8期中,<jsp创建基于WEB的动态图表>一文中的些许错误
声明下,这个错误是在实践过程中发现的,并不代表没有解决办法.   文中在jsp中直接用 outputstream=response.getoutputstream(); 获得response的输出流,然后向这个输出流写image信息. 在实际运行中,tomcat会报错, 不知作者是怎么解决的. 经过研究,发现这个问题是由于jsp转换成servlet的时候形成的, jsp 在转换成se
分类:Java 查阅全文
Eclipse tips
 2004-06-30 15:15:18 from http://tendant.mysmth.net         今天coding的时候一不小心用右键菜单中的Close Project 中的功能将正在编辑的项目给关掉了,弄得偶摸不着头脑(土啊:)),后来才发现原来Eclipse 中可以将不需要的项目关掉,这样
分类:Java 查阅全文
IntelliJ IDEA和Eclipse
      相信国内Java高手一般会选择这两款工具,究其原因就是IntelliJ IDEA智能、功能强大,Eclipse开源,plugin多。好多人或企业会问如何选择这两款工具,谁最好?其实这没有答案,看你如何理解。      如果单纯从开发方面讲,Eclipse的功能确实不如IDEA,IDEA毕竟是商业
分类:Java 查阅全文
用java程序从propeties文件中读取参数值
有时候我们需要将某些参数的值写在程序外的文件中,让程序从这些文件中读取参数值。这样,我们改变这些参数值时,不必修改源程序。 先用记事本新建一个文本文件,改后缀名.properties。这里新建一个文本文件,写上:#最大用户连接数            ----#是注释符max_clien
分类:Java 查阅全文
服务开启时用servlet自动进行初始化
写一个servlet: package colorring; import javax.servlet.*;import javax.servlet.http.*;import java.io.*;import com.soutec.g_log.Config; public class InitLog extends HttpServlet {     pub
分类:Java 查阅全文
<< 155 156 157 158 159 160 161 162 163 164 165 166 167 168 169 170 171 172 173 174 175 >>